
Java下载如何防止随便下载
为了防止Java被随意下载,您可以采取以下措施:使用受信任的下载源、启用下载权限控制、部署企业内部软件分发系统、实施严格的网络安全策略。其中,使用受信任的下载源是最重要的一点,因为它可以保证下载的Java版本是官方和安全的,这样可以避免因下载不安全的Java版本而带来的潜在风险。
使用受信任的下载源:确保从官方网站或受信任的来源下载Java软件,这样可以避免下载到带有恶意软件或病毒的Java安装包。Oracle官网是下载Java的最佳选择,因为它提供了最新的安全更新和补丁。此外,一些知名的第三方下载平台也可以作为备选方案,但务必要确认其安全性和可信度。
一、使用受信任的下载源
从官方网站或受信任的来源下载Java软件是防止随便下载的首要措施。官方网站如Oracle官网提供了最新的Java版本和安全补丁,确保下载的Java版本没有被篡改或带有恶意软件。
1.1、Oracle官网
Oracle是Java的官方维护者,Oracle官网提供了最新和最稳定的Java版本。访问Oracle官网可以确保您下载的Java软件是最新的,并且包括了所有的安全补丁和更新。Oracle官网还提供了详细的安装指南和文档,帮助用户正确安装和配置Java。
1.2、第三方下载平台
虽然Oracle官网是下载Java的最佳选择,但有时也可以从一些知名的第三方下载平台下载。然而,选择第三方平台时务必要确认其安全性和可信度。一些知名的第三方平台如GitHub、SourceForge等,可以作为Oracle官网的备选方案。但应注意,下载前要检查平台的安全性,并确保下载链接指向的是官方资源。
二、启用下载权限控制
控制谁可以下载和安装Java软件也是防止随便下载的重要措施。通过启用下载权限控制,可以限制只有特定用户或用户组才有权限下载和安装Java软件,从而减少随便下载的风险。
2.1、操作系统层面的权限控制
大多数操作系统,如Windows、macOS和Linux,都提供了权限管理功能。通过操作系统的权限管理功能,可以限制普通用户的下载和安装权限。例如,在Windows中,可以通过组策略限制用户的下载权限;在macOS和Linux中,可以通过修改文件权限和用户组来实现这一目标。
2.2、企业内部的权限管理
在企业环境中,可以通过内部权限管理系统来控制员工的下载权限。许多企业使用Active Directory、LDAP等系统来管理员工的权限。通过这些系统,可以设置下载和安装软件的权限,确保只有授权的员工才能下载和安装Java软件。此外,还可以使用企业内部的软件分发系统,集中管理和分发Java软件,进一步减少随便下载的风险。
三、部署企业内部软件分发系统
企业内部软件分发系统是防止随便下载Java软件的有效手段之一。通过这种系统,可以集中管理和分发Java软件,确保员工只能从受信任的内部源下载和安装Java软件。
3.1、软件分发系统的优势
部署企业内部软件分发系统有许多优势。首先,可以集中管理Java软件的版本和更新,确保所有员工使用的都是最新和安全的版本。其次,可以通过分发系统控制下载权限,只有授权的员工才能下载和安装Java软件。此外,软件分发系统还可以提供详细的下载和安装记录,便于追踪和管理。
3.2、常见的软件分发系统
有许多企业级的软件分发系统可以选择,如Microsoft SCCM、IBM BigFix、JAMF等。这些系统提供了强大的管理功能,可以帮助企业集中管理和分发Java软件。通过这些系统,企业可以设置下载和安装权限,自动推送更新,监控下载和安装情况,确保Java软件的安全性和合规性。
四、实施严格的网络安全策略
实施严格的网络安全策略是防止随便下载Java软件的另一个重要措施。通过网络安全策略,可以限制用户访问不受信任的网站和下载不安全的软件,从而减少随便下载的风险。
4.1、网络访问控制
通过网络访问控制,可以限制用户访问不受信任的网站,从而减少下载不安全Java软件的风险。可以通过防火墙、代理服务器等设备,设置访问控制策略,限制用户只能访问受信任的网站。此外,还可以使用网络监控工具,实时监控用户的网络活动,及时发现和阻止不安全的下载行为。
4.2、网络安全培训
网络安全培训也是防止随便下载的重要措施之一。通过定期的网络安全培训,可以提高员工的安全意识,帮助他们识别和避免不安全的下载行为。培训内容可以包括如何识别受信任的网站和下载源、如何防范网络钓鱼攻击、如何正确下载和安装软件等。通过培训,员工可以更好地理解和遵守企业的网络安全策略,从而减少随便下载的风险。
五、使用沙箱和虚拟化技术
使用沙箱和虚拟化技术也是防止随便下载Java软件的有效措施之一。通过这些技术,可以在隔离的环境中运行和测试下载的软件,确保其安全性和可靠性。
5.1、沙箱技术
沙箱技术是一种安全机制,通过在隔离的环境中运行软件,可以防止恶意软件对系统造成危害。通过沙箱技术,可以先在沙箱中运行和测试下载的Java软件,确保其没有恶意行为,然后再在生产环境中安装和使用。常见的沙箱工具有Sandboxie、Firejail等。
5.2、虚拟化技术
虚拟化技术也是一种有效的隔离手段。通过虚拟机,可以在隔离的虚拟环境中运行和测试下载的Java软件,确保其安全性。虚拟化技术不仅可以防止恶意软件对系统造成危害,还可以在多个虚拟环境中同时测试不同版本的Java软件,确保兼容性和稳定性。常见的虚拟化工具有VMware, VirtualBox等。
六、使用端点保护和防病毒软件
端点保护和防病毒软件是防止随便下载Java软件的最后一道防线。通过这些安全软件,可以实时监控和阻止不安全的下载行为,确保下载的Java软件没有被恶意软件感染。
6.1、端点保护软件
端点保护软件是一种综合性的安全解决方案,提供了多层次的保护功能,包括防病毒、防恶意软件、入侵检测等。通过端点保护软件,可以实时监控和阻止不安全的下载行为,确保下载的Java软件是安全的。常见的端点保护软件有Symantec Endpoint Protection, McAfee Endpoint Security等。
6.2、防病毒软件
防病毒软件是防止恶意软件感染的主要工具。通过防病毒软件,可以实时扫描和检测下载的Java软件,确保其没有被病毒感染。此外,防病毒软件还可以提供实时保护功能,阻止恶意软件的下载和运行。常见的防病毒软件有Norton, Kaspersky, Bitdefender等。
七、定期更新和审核
定期更新和审核是确保Java软件安全性的重要措施之一。通过定期更新,可以确保Java软件包括最新的安全补丁和更新,通过定期审核,可以发现和修复潜在的安全漏洞。
7.1、定期更新
定期更新Java软件是确保其安全性的重要手段。通过定期检查和安装最新的安全补丁和更新,可以修复已知的安全漏洞,防止恶意软件利用这些漏洞进行攻击。可以设置自动更新功能,确保Java软件始终保持最新版本。
7.2、定期审核
定期审核Java软件的下载和安装情况,可以发现和修复潜在的安全漏洞。通过审核,可以检查是否有未经授权的下载和安装行为,是否有未安装最新安全补丁的Java软件,及时发现和处理安全问题。可以使用安全审计工具,如Nessus, OpenVAS等,进行定期的安全审核。
综上所述,防止Java被随便下载需要采取多层次的安全措施,包括使用受信任的下载源、启用下载权限控制、部署企业内部软件分发系统、实施严格的网络安全策略、使用沙箱和虚拟化技术、使用端点保护和防病毒软件、定期更新和审核等。通过这些措施,可以有效减少Java随便下载的风险,确保Java软件的安全性和可靠性。
相关问答FAQs:
1. 如何限制Java下载的权限?
为了防止随意下载Java应用程序,您可以通过限制用户的权限来控制其下载行为。可以使用权限管理工具,如Java Security Manager,来限制用户对特定资源的访问权限。通过配置访问策略文件,您可以指定哪些类可以被用户下载和执行,从而保护您的系统免受恶意下载的威胁。
2. 如何验证Java下载的来源可信度?
为了确保您从可信的来源下载Java应用程序,您可以遵循以下最佳实践:
- 仅从官方Java网站或其他受信任的软件分发网站下载Java。
- 在下载之前,查看用户评价和评论,了解其他用户对该软件的反馈。
- 使用安全的下载链接,确保下载的文件没有被篡改。
- 在下载之前,使用安全软件对下载的文件进行扫描,以检测是否存在恶意软件或病毒。
3. 如何防止Java下载过程中的安全漏洞?
为了保护您的系统免受Java下载过程中的安全漏洞的影响,您可以采取以下措施:
- 及时更新Java版本,以获取最新的安全补丁和修复程序。
- 确保您的操作系统和浏览器也得到最新的安全更新。
- 避免从不受信任的网站或链接下载Java应用程序。
- 在下载之前,使用安全软件对下载的文件进行扫描,以检测是否存在恶意软件或病毒。
- 定期进行系统和应用程序的安全性检查,以及漏洞扫描,及时修复潜在的安全问题。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/309830